Analysis of the Chris Paul-Clippers separation and the team’s challenging season

In a season marked by high expectations and disappointing outcomes, the Los Angeles Clippers’ reunion with veteran point guard Chris Paul has come to an abrupt end. The separation, which follows a tumultuous campaign for the franchise, raises questions about the future direction of the team and the legacy of one of the NBA’s all-time greats.

Chris Paul, a nine-time All-Star and future Hall of Famer, returned to the Clippers in July 2023 after spending six seasons with the Houston Rockets, Oklahoma City Thunder, and Phoenix Suns. His initial tenure with the Clippers from 2011 to 2017 was characterized by significant success, including multiple playoff appearances and a reputation as one of the league’s premier point guards. However, the team’s inability to advance past the Western Conference Finals during that period has cast a long shadow over Paul’s legacy in Los Angeles.

The 2023-2024 season began with optimism, as the Clippers aimed to capitalize on Paul’s experience and leadership to complement their star-studded roster, which includes Kawhi Leonard and Paul George. However, the season quickly unraveled. Injuries plagued the team, with Leonard and George missing significant time, and the Clippers struggled to find consistency on both ends of the court. By mid-January, the team had a record of 18-25, placing them in the lower tier of the Western Conference standings.

The Clippers’ struggles were compounded by the challenges of integrating Paul into a system that had evolved since his departure. The team had shifted its focus to a more perimeter-oriented style of play, which contrasted with Paul’s traditional playmaking approach. This disconnect became evident as the season progressed, leading to questions about the effectiveness of the reunion.

The decision to part ways with Paul was announced in early February 2024, following a series of disappointing performances and mounting frustration within the organization. The Clippers cited a desire to explore new directions and rebuild their roster around younger talent. The separation was amicable, with both parties expressing mutual respect and gratitude for their time together.

The implications of this separation extend beyond the immediate future of the Clippers. For Paul, the decision marks a critical juncture in his career. At 38 years old, he is at the tail end of his playing days and seeking one final opportunity to compete for an NBA championship. His departure from the Clippers raises questions about his next steps, as he weighs potential offers from other teams looking to bolster their rosters with veteran leadership.

For the Clippers, the separation signals a broader reevaluation of their roster and strategy. The team has been mired in a cycle of disappointment since the arrival of Leonard and George in 2019, failing to meet the lofty expectations set by their star power. The front office is now tasked with determining the best path forward, which may involve trading key players or investing in younger talent through the draft.

The Clippers’ challenges are not unique to their franchise. The NBA landscape is increasingly competitive, with several teams vying for supremacy in the Western Conference. The emergence of young stars and the rise of franchises like the Denver Nuggets and Memphis Grizzlies have intensified the pressure on established teams to adapt or risk falling behind.

As the Clippers navigate this transitional phase, they must also contend with the realities of their market. Los Angeles is home to two NBA teams, and the Clippers have historically played second fiddle to the Los Angeles Lakers. Building a sustainable and competitive team in this environment requires strategic planning and a commitment to long-term success.

The separation from Chris Paul serves as a poignant reminder of the fleeting nature of success in professional sports. While Paul’s contributions to the Clippers during his initial tenure were significant, the team’s inability to capitalize on that success has left a lasting impact on both his legacy and the franchise’s trajectory. As the Clippers look to the future, they must reconcile their past with the need for a new identity in a rapidly evolving league.

In conclusion, the separation between Chris Paul and the Los Angeles Clippers marks the end of an era for both the player and the franchise. As the Clippers seek to redefine their approach and Paul contemplates his next move, the implications of this decision will resonate throughout the league, shaping the narratives of both the team and one of basketball’s most accomplished players.
